Concept Group acquires majority stake in Lastmile Solutions

The investment comes through a combination of fresh issue of equity and infusion of debt

This adds to Concept Communications, Concept PR, Enormous Brands, Liqvd Asia and NIQX Informatics

Concept Communication has made an investment in Lastmile Solutions India by acquiring a majority stake through a combination of fresh issue of equity and infusion of debt.
 
Lastmile Solutions was founded in 2013 by Atul Maheshwari and Pankaj Goswami and in the business of retail visual identity solutions, branding, design and merchandising display, activation and promotion, events and OOH. 
 
Atul Maheshwari, founder and CEO, Lastmile Solutions, said, “We are thrilled to be part of the Concept Communications group, which will enable us to exponentially scale our business. Being part of the retail and BTL divisions of several leading agencies in my professional career, I went about establishing LMS to meet the needs of brands to provide a single window service for events, consumer and trade activation, signage, branding, retail store roll outs and retail launches."
 
Vivek Suchanti, MD, Concept Communications, said, "Concept is always looking at partnerships which enable us to offer our clients all services at a single point. LMS while adding to our service offering comes with an enthusiastic and determined team which is creating new benchmarks in their space using design, technology and delivery to ensure client delight. We appreciate their entrepreneurial spirit which embodies the Concept spirit. Strategically the fit could not be better."
